Summary

Plans and implements professional nursing care for patients in accordance with hospital policies. Assumes charge nurse responsibilities as assigned.

Major Job Functions

  • Affirms patient care needs through assessment
  • Organizes appropriate patient care based on assessment information
  • Implements and evaluates patient care plans
  • Maintains a safe environment
  • Maintains required competencies
  • Assumes charge nurse responsibilities as assigned
  • Maintains an accurate and relevant record of patient care
  • Administers medication as ordered by physician
  • Recognizes and responds to life-threatening situations
  • Fosters collaborative interdisciplinary relationships
  • Maintains quality of care based on outcome-oriented indicators
  • Participates in cost containment and accurate charging for patient services
  • Adjusts care based on age-specific physiological and psychosocial needs
  • Supports patients in practicing their cultural and spiritual beliefs within medical regimen
  • Performs other duties as assigned

Minimum Qualifications

  • Associates Degree in Nursing required
  • Bachelor's Degree in Nursing preferred
  • Current licensure in North Carolina as a Registered Nurse or Compact state licensure

Knowledge, Skills, And Abilities

  • Demonstrates positive interpersonal skills
  • Verbal and written skills required
  • Effective organizational and leadership skills
  • Knowledge of age-specific physiological and psychosocial, developmental, and spiritual needs of patients typically served

Physical Requirements

  • Standing, walking, bending, and lifting required
  • May involve skin, eye, mucous membrane, or parenteral contact with blood or other potentially infectious material

Required Licenses And Certifications

  • BLS - American Heart Association
  • RN - Board of Nursing
